Drug Class: What is Budesonide-Formoterol Rotacap and why is it prescribed? | ||
Budesonide–Formoterol is an inhaled corticosteroid medication used to prevent bronchospasm in people with asthma or ch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D). This combination medication reduces wheezing and trouble breathing caused by asthma or COPD. | ||

Drug Mechanism: How does Budesonide-Formoterol Rotacap work? | ||
These drugs represent two classes of medications (a synthetic corticosteroid and a long-acting, selective beta2-adrenoceptor agonist) that have different effects on the clinical, physiological, and inflammatory indices of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ease (COPD) asthma. The medication contains two different drug components: budesonide and formoterol. Formoterol is part of a class of drugs called beta-adrenergic receptor agonists, or beta agonists for short. Dosage: How should you take Budesonide-Formoterol Rotacap? | ||
The dosage of Budesonide–Formoterol prescribed to each patient will vary. Always follow your physician’s instructions and/or the directions on the prescription drug label. Missed Dose of Budesonide–Formoterol If your physician has instructed or directed you to use Budesonide–Formoterol medication in a regular schedule and you have missed a dose of this medicine, use it as soon as you remember. However, if it is almost time for your next dose, then skip the missed dose and go back to your regular dosing schedule. Do not double the doses unless otherwise directed.
